METZELER KAROO STREETS<br />
Now tyres are an area of much debate.<br />
My choice here has been partly<br />
determined by the need (want?) to ride<br />
to and from Morocco and to compete<br />
in the event all on the one set of tyres.<br />
With probably 6000km to cover that’s<br />
on the very limit of what a set of regular<br />
dirt-biased adventure tyres can do.<br />
Note here that I also want decent street<br />
performance, I don’t like the idea of<br />
sliding down wet tarmac because a<br />
distance-oriented tyre lacked grip at a<br />
crucial moment.<br />
